As a teacher in China I know it is necessary to obtain a Release Letter from a school in order to renew a Z visa to teach in another school. But is it necessary to also obtain a Letter of Recommendation in order to renew the Z visa and obtain a new Foreign Expert Certificate?

you only need the release letter, the letter of recommendation is only for your personal use when looking for a new job to show at the interview
A release letter is something totally different than a 'letter of recommendation'.
To get a 'letter of recommendation' one has to ask for it and it is not a normal
thing in China. When I asked for it they did not know what I wanted and asked
me to write it for them and then they 'would see' if they could approve it. They did
approve and wrote it for me and signed it and sealed it with their rubber stamp;
i.e. red star.
Same as above. The letter of recommendation is separate, and I have usually been told to write my own, then they translate it, so it is in both languages.
